2009-07-21 8 views
0

私は困っています - イメージのURLを更新するとブラウザが更新されません(ホストモード、Firefox)GWT。イメージを読み込んで複合します

img.setUrl( "..."); //時々動かないでしょう

私は更新URLが必要なたびに新しい画像をインスタンス化しようとしています。私は使用します img = new Image( "..."); は私のSimplePanelにあります。

ホストモードでは動作しますが、firefoxでは動作しません。ページをリロードするときにShift +リフレッシュを押すとキャッシュがクリアされます。

DOM.setElementAttribute(Image.getElement()、 "src"、path)のようなハック;助けにならないでしょう。

答えて

1

すでに読み込まれていたURLに設定すると、ブラウザを使用して画像を更新しなくても困ります。すでにロードされていたので、ブラウザはキャッシュ内の内容を表示しました。私はこれがまったく同じ問題であるかどうかは分かりませんが、私の周りにはURLを使用しています+ "? + aRandomNumberとなり、ブラウザはキャッシュからプルするのではなくイメージをリロードします。

+0

確かにキャッシングの問題のような音です。 – Carnell

関連する問題